I have been noticing intermittent gasoline smell outside of vehicle. It has been smelling stronger and more often so I decided to inspect it for the second. I removed the carpet and fuel pump cover and discovered the fuel pump is leaking gas. Now I cannot drive vehicle due to gasoline leaking every time the ignition is on. It is a serious safety and fire hazard. I have not contacted the dealer because it is not under warranty.
The contact owns a 2015 Infiniti QX80. The contact stated while the vehicle was parked at the residence, he attempted to start the vehicle and the vehicle failed to start. There were no warning lights illuminated. The contact waited for a while before attempting to restart the vehicle. The vehicle was towed to an independent mechanic and was diagnosed with a defective fuel pump. The vehicle was not repaired. The manufacturer was notified of the failure. The approximate failure mileage was 95,000.
TL* THE CONTACT OWNS A 2015 INFINITI QX80. THE CONTACT STATED THAT WHILE ACCELERATING FROM A STOP SIGN, THERE WAS AN ABNORMAL SOUND COMING FROM THE VEHICLE. THE CONTACT VEERED TO THE SHOULDER OF THE ROADWAY TO INSPECT THE VEHICLE BUT FOUND NO ISSUES. THE CONTACT DROVE THE VEHICLE TO AN INDEPENDENT MECHANIC TO BE DIAGNOSED. THE CONTACT WAS INFORMED THAT THE HIGH-PRESSURE FUEL CAP HAD DISINTEGRATED WHICH CAUSED METAL FRAGMENTS TO ENTER THE ENGINE. THE CONTACT WAS INFORMED THAT THE VIN WAS NOT UNDER RECALL. THE CONTACT REFERENCED NHTSA CAMPAIGN NUMBER: 14V683000 (FUEL SYSTEM, GASOLINE) AS A POSSIBLE SOLUTION TO THE FAILURE HOWEVER, THE VIN WAS NOT INCLUDED. THE FAILURE MILEAGE WAS APPROXIMATELY 99,000.
